In this biweekly podcast, Mandy Elliott and Charlie Barber choose a movie to watch, discuss, make fun of, and fight about. They talk a lot about issues of race, gender, and sexuality and their conversations are intellectual, yet refreshingly irreverent.Mandy Elliott and Charlie Barber Art

We're in the midst of our Tarsem Singh-a-thon, and today we bring you a discussion of Immortals (2011), a very silly sword and sandal film about Theseus and Phaedra (sort of) and their interactions with a monomaniacal king, random characters of Greek myth, and the gods, who are never quite sure what they want. Oh, and HATS. This movie is honestly mostly nonsense, but it looks great.
